2018 Tomato Harvest

Last week we harvested tomatoes from our farm and used them for cooking at Stanley's. This was a mini-milestone for us. It was the first time we've ever harvested food from our farm and used it for cooking. All the tomatoes used as toppings on our pizza last weekend came from our farm.

For our first season, we planted 52 different species (mostly heirloom) with colorful names such as Berkeley Tie Die Green, Toad Suck Toad, Ghost Cherry, Cream Sausage, Tasmanian Chocolate and Pink Furry Boar.

Our first tomato harvest has been pretty small scale, with only about a 90 pound yield. We'll work to increase that with time, and ultimately hope for our farm to provide most, if not all, of the food for our kitchen.
